The Federal Road Safety Corps has launched Operation Shark Smile, a special enforcement exercise by its Zone 6 Headquarters in Port Harcourt aimed at reducing road crashes caused by persistent traffic violations.

The operation, which runs from July 20 to July 22, 2026, will be carried out simultaneously across Zone 6 states, including Akwa Ibom, with FRSC personnel working alongside other security agencies to enforce traffic regulations.

According to the FRSC, the exercise will target offences such as overloading, number plate violations, dangerous driving, worn out tyres, speeding, use of mobile phones while driving, defective vehicles, failure to install speed limiters, windscreen violations and seat belt offences.

Sector Commander, Corps Commander Felicia M. Kalu, said the operation will involve increased deployment of personnel, patrol vehicles, ambulances and tow trucks to improve emergency response and enhance road safety.

The FRSC says offenders will be prosecuted or required to pay the prescribed fines in line with existing traffic regulations.
